Planning appeal decision
Wynsors, 243-249 East Prescot Road, LIVERPOOL, L14 5NA
2no. non-illuminated 48-sheet poster panels

Main issues, as the Inspector framed them
- The effect of the poster panel advertisements on the visual amenity of the area including whether or not they will preserve or enhance the character or appearance of the Knotty Ash Conservation Area
What decided it
The proposed advertisements would be detrimental to visual amenity and would fail to preserve or enhance the character and appearance of the Knotty Ash Conservation Area, conflicting with the statutory duty under Section 72(1) of the Planning (Listed Buildings and Conservation Areas) Act 1990.
